China has removed six top military officers, a former financial regulator, and a former Politburo member from their legislative posts, signaling President Xi Jinping's ongoing anti-corruption purge. China has removed six senior PLA officers from the country’s top legislative body, a sign that President Xi Jinping’s military anti-corruption campaign is not slowing down.
Times of India reported the story as "Xi's military purge widens: China strips 6 generals, ex-Politburo member of lawmaker posts." South China Morning Post reported the story as "China removes 6 generals from legislature as military anti-corruption drive continues."
